Java Engineer Bangalore

 Posted 3 days ago
  
 India
  
5-10 years experience
Apply Now

Please mention DailyRemote when applying

AI Summary

Lead the design and implementation of core platform features and API development. Provide operational support through monitoring tools, performance testing, and defect resolution.
  
Candidate Qualifications:    
 
  • Overall 8+ years of developing internet-scale solution development primarily using Java, Spring Boot and no-sql databases    
 
  • Must have demonstrated proficiency and experience in the following tools and technologies:  
 
  • Java 11 (Lambdas, Streams, Completable Future, optional, generics)  
 
  • Spring boot (webflux , Reactor 3), spring-data, REST  
 
  • Java functional and reactive programming  
 
  • Test Driven Development   
 
  • Asynchronous Reactive Micro services utilizing Vert.x     
 
  • REST APIs using Spring Boot 2.0 (reactive) and skilled in Open API (swagger) specification   
 
  • Designing database schemas, index design, optimizations for query tuning    
 
  • Working knowledge of cloud technologies (eg.  docker, kubernetes, jager, prometheus)  
 
  • Modern software engineering tools: git workflows, gradle, load testing tools, mock frameworks   
 
  • Good knowledge of messaging systems like Kafka, mq  
 
  • Take pride in writing good clean code, perform peer code reviews and architecture reviews.  
 
  • A bachelor's degree in engineering or related field    
 
  • Java certification is a plus 
 
 

 

Similar Jobs

See all Remote Software Development jobs →

Personalize your Remote Job Search in 3 Easy Steps!

Discover remote opportunities in Software Development

Answer easy questions

Answer easy questions

200,000+ jobs across 15+ categories

Get your best job matches

Get your best job matches

Only hand-screened, legit jobs

Find a remote job faster

Find a remote job faster

No ads, scams, or junk

I was the first applicant for a remote marketing position that got listed on the company website the same day I applied. Had an interview within 48 hours!

Sarah J. — Sarah J. · Marketing Manager ★★★★★ Verified